Seems like the Jordan Phase is starting to die down and it seems like Dunks, or other type of sneakers are in. I'm sure anyone who used to be sneaker head or is still is a sneaker head will agree with me on this. What happen to the early wake up calls and standing few hours online for a pair of released Jordan's? It used to be about , who had the freshest Jordan's or sneaker on and now it died down. Now they're fusing Air Jordan's with Air Force Ones. Okay, I'm not a fan of this at all because it ruins the legacy and the classic of the shoes. Let me be the first of many to say, I'm DISAPPOINTED IN JORDAN BRAND.

Lastly, fashion styles these days has changed. Everyone has gone fitted and is trying to look proper and neat. Back then, jerseys to baggy jeans and baggy shirts were in style. Now its all about the fitted jeans and the fitted shirts. I guess everything got complicated now because back then, if someone saw you in skinny jeans and a fitted shirt, you would get made fun of and they will call harsh uncalled for names. Now, they complement you on how you put your style together. Fashion has changed over time and well, this is just the beginning. I kinda missed the baggy days because it made me feel like i was once a teenager without any mind of responsibility. Now it's all about responsibilities and being focus on everything you do.
